Concrete raising services involve elevating s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position and levelness. This process typically uses specialized materials, such as polyurethane foam, to lift the affected areas without the need for extensive demolition or replacement. The procedure is designed to quickly and effectively address issues caused by ground movement, soil erosion, or settlement beneath concrete surfaces, helping to improve the stability and appearance of the affected area.
These services are often sought to solve problems associated with uneven or cracked concrete surfaces. When slabs sink or settle, they can create tripping hazards, make driveways or walkways difficult to navigate, and diminish the overall curb appeal of a property. Concrete raising can help restore safety, prevent further damage, and maintain the structural integrity of surfaces such as dri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ors.

Cost Range - Concrete raising services typically cost between $500 and $1,500 per slab, depending on size and extent of damage. Smaller repairs may be closer to the lower end, while larger areas can approach the higher end of the range.
Factors Affecting Cost - The complexity of the lift and the accessibility of the area influence pricing, with typical expenses varying based on the number of slabs and soil conditions. Additional work, such as crack repair, may increase the overall cost.
Average Prices - In Clay County, MO, the average cost for concrete raising services generally falls between $600 and $1,200 per slab. Prices can fluctuate based on local contractor rates and specific project requirements.
Cost Variability - Prices for concrete raising are variable and depend on factors like the size of the area and the severity of sinking. Typical costs are subject to change and should be confirmed with local service providers during consultation.

What is concrete raising? Concrete raising involves lifting and leveling s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position and improve safety and appearance.
How do local contractors perform concrete raising? Professionals typically use specialized materials, such as foam or mudjacking mixtures, to lift and stabilize the concrete efficiently.
Is concrete raising suitable for all types of concrete damage? Concrete raising is most effective for slabs that have settled or shifted; it may not be appropriate for severely cracked or damaged concrete.
How long does concrete raising typically take? The process usually takes a few hours, depending on the size and condition of the area being repaired.
